About On My Way Pre-K

Free, high-quality pre-K program for eligible 4-year-olds in Indiana. Funded by the state to help children arrive at kindergarten ready to learn.

How to Apply in Indiana

  1. Visit OnMyWayPreK.org to find participating providers near you
  2. Child must turn 4 by August 1 of the program year
  3. Family income must be at or below 140% of the federal poverty level
  4. Apply online or contact your local provider
